Replying to Avatar NotBiebs and 69 others

Yeah this dude Neeraj at Coin Center made the original meme in like 2018 and for years many people thought it was real 😂

Avatar
The Daniel 🖖 1y ago

Still funny.

Reply to this note

Please Login to reply.

Discussion

No replies yet.